Sec. 2. Notification of investigation regarding professional conduct; submission of records

Title VIII of the Indian Health Care Improvement Act ( 25 U.S.C. 1671 et seq. ) is amended by adding at the end the following: Not later than 14 calendar days after the date on which the Service undertakes an investigation into the professional conduct of a licensee of a State, the Secretary, acting through the Service, shall notify the relevant State medical board of the investigation. Not later than 14 calendar days after the date on which the Service generates records relating to an investigation conducted by the Service into the professional conduct of a licensee of a State, the Secretary, acting through the Service, shall provide the records to the relevant State medical board. .
